Demolition, site work, paving and outdoor lighting for a mixed-use development in Ontario, Oregon. Completed plans call for site work for a road / highway; for paving for a road / highway; bridge / tunnel; for the demolition of a bridge / tunnel; sidewalk / parking lot; sidewalk / parking lot; and for outdoor lighting for a road / highway.

Region 5 I-84: Farewell Bend - N. Fork Jacobsen Gulch Section of the Old Oregon Trail & Huntington Hwys Bryan Strasser, RE I-84: Farewell Bend - N. Fork Jacobsen Gulch Section of the Old Oregon Trail & Huntington Highways (Rt. No. I-84 & US30) beginning near Huntington. FAP No. SA00(600). (Over $ 30,000,000). This Project Contains a 6% Dbe Goal. Project Manager: Bryan Strasser, Email: Bryan.e.strasser@odot.oregon.gov Email the Project Manager Listed at the End of Each Announcement for Project Specific Technical Questions Completion Time: September 30, 2027 Class of Work: Classes of Work: either A) Asphalt Concrete Paving and Oiling, or B) Portland Cement Concrete Paving. This project contains asphalt and fuel escalation clauses. The Oregon Department of Transportation is an Equal Employment Opportunity and Affirmative Action Employer. To be eligible for award of Oregon Department of Transportation construction contracts, bidders (prime contractors) must submit a prequalification application according to ODOt's Oregon Administrative Rules and prequalification procedures at least ten calendar days before the Bid Closing date. Prequalification must be in the class(es) of work indicated in the project's special provisions, and the bid booklet. ORDOT - 001 - I-84: Farewell Bend - N. Fork Jacobsen Gulch The Work to be done under this Contract consists of the following: 1. Install temporary traffic control. 2. Construct paving. 3. Construct bridge rehabilitation and repairs. 4. Install VMS signs, structures & footings . 5. Install weigh in motion equipment. 6. Install illumination. 7. Perform additional and Incidental Work as called for by the Specifications and Plans
